#ff3612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ff3612 is composed of 100% red, 21.2%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 9.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 53.5%. #ff3612 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c24 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#ff3612 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ff3612 has RGB values of R:255, G:54,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.93, K:0. Its decimal value is 16725522.

Shades and Tints of #ff3612
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120300 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ff3612
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92827f is the less saturated color, while #ff3612 is the most saturated one.
